Yaron Zelekha


Yaron Zelekha is an Israeli economist. He was an Israeli Ministry of Finance accountant general during 2003–2007. He was a key witness, according to state comptroller's office, who testified against Ehud Olmert in his role of finance minister in a case of alleged bribery during the sale of the Bank Leumi's controlling shares. Zelekha said that State of Israel is more corrupt than it appears.
In 2011, Zelekha was chosen to head a committee for examining centralization in the private vehicle market in Israel.
